About the sensor microwave features.
Popcorn 1
Popcorn
To use the Popcorn feature:
[]
Follow package instructions, using Cook if
the package is lessthan 1.0 ounces or
larger than 3.5 ounces. Place the
package of popcorn in the center of the
turntable.
[]
Pressthe POPCORN buttononcefor 3.3 to 3.5
ounce bagsor twicefor 2.7to 3.0ounce bags
or threetimes for 1.0to 1.5ounce bags.
Iffood is undercooked after the countdown,use
TimeCookfor additionalcookingtime.
Use only with prepackaged microwave
popcorn weighing 1.0 to 3.5 ounces.
NOTE: Do not use this feature
twice in
succession
on the same food portion--it
may result
in severely
overcooked
or
burnt
food

TheReheat featurereheatsservingsof previously
cookedfoodsor a plateof leftovers.
[]
Place the cup of liquid or covered
food in the oven. Press REHEATonce, twice, or
three times. The oven starts immediately.
Press once for a plate of leftovers.
Press twice for a pasta.
Press three times for 1/2 to 2 cups of
vegetables.
[]
The oven signals when steam is
sensed and the time remaining begins
counting down.
Donot openthe ovendoor until time
is countingdown.If the door is opened,
closeit and pressSTART/PAUSE immediately.
After remodng food from the oven, stir, if possibfe,
to even out the temperature. Reheated foods may
hove wide voriotbns in temperature. Some areas of
food may be extremely hot.
If food isnot hot enoughafter the countdown use
TimeCookfor additionalreheatingtime.
SomeFoodsNot Recommended for Use
With Reheat
It isbest to use TimeCookfor thesefoods:
Breadproducts.
Foodsthat mustbe reheateduncovered.
Foodsthat needto be stirredor rotated.
Foodscattingfor a dry tookor crisp surfaceafter
reheating.
NOTE:Do not use this feature twice in
succession on the same food portion--it
may result in severely overcooked or
burnt food.
